Durning summer, the sun beats down relentlessly, turning the city into a concrete oven. You overhear conversations at every corner: "It's unbearable!" "I can't wait for winter!" But, as the seasons change, so do the complaints. "This cold is killing me!" "When will spring arrive?"
When I hear this, I think about the futility of these grumbles. The weather, in its eternal dance, has been performing the same routine for ages. Summer brings heat, winter ushers in cold, spring blooms with rain, and autumn dries the leaves. It's a cycle as old as the Earth itself.
Why complain about something you cannot change, influence or control?
It’s better to think of the weather not as an inconvenience to be endured, but as a teacher of adaptability and acceptance. Your body is an incredible instrument. It is capable of adjusting to a wide range of conditions. It's not the temperature that causes suffering, but your resistance to it.
Transcend these petty complaints. Embrace each season with the same enthusiasm a child greets a new adventure. The scorching summer sun becomes an opportunity to appreciate the coolness of shade or the refreshing sensation of jumping in a pool. The chilly winter invites you to savor the warmth of a cozy fire or a homemade soup. And if extreme heat or cold makes you a little uncomfortable, just remember that discomfort is temporary.
Don’t let external conditions dictate your inner state. True contentment comes from within, not from perfect temperatures. Enjoy every type of conditions. Whether it’s scorching hot or freezing cold, choose to rise above the complaints. Embrace the weather as it comes. Your body will adapt.
